Why is my computer screen black but I can see my mouse?

Black screen with cursor, otherwise known as a black screen of death error, is typically a result of a Windows system crash – it occurs during a critical error, and the OS is not capable of booting. As a result, all users see is a movable cursor, but nothing else is visible on the screen, apart from a black background.

How do I fix a black screen with just the cursor Windows 7?

When Windows 7 gets to a black screen with a cursor and gets stuck there, it is likely that there are corrupted system files in your computer. One of the best ways to fix this is using System File Checker (SFC). This tool will look for corrupted system files and repair them accordingly.

Why is my HP laptop screen black but I can see the mouse?

The notebook screen display might remain black when there is a corrupted graphics driver or a problem with the LCD display backlight. To test the display, attach an external monitor and restart the computer.

Why has my laptop screen gone black?

We’ll look at some things that can cause a black or blank screen: Connection problems with your monitor or screen. Display adapter driver update issues. Issues with recent system updates or installations.
